见 docs/architecture.md 第一节
8 人日
设计文档已更新: docs/design-spec.md 对应章节: 1.1 frontend/前端结构 + 5.1 大屏组件树 请参照该章节的数据库DDL、API端点规范、前端组件树、数据流图进行开发。
提交: 71182e2e (feature/dev) 文件变更: 26个文件,4078行代码新增,1444行代码删除
请审核。
A-git: 远程分支 feature/dev 存在,commit 71182e2e 提交信息清晰,明确引用 Issue #23。✅
feature/dev
71182e2e
B-文件: 26 个文件变更(+4078/-1444),覆盖 Vue3 + TypeScript + Element Plus 项目初始化、认证系统(登录/注册/忘记密码)、主布局组件 + 路由系统、用户管理模块、供水总览大屏可视化、Axios 封装 + API 模块、ECharts 图表、ESLint + Prettier 规范、Vite 构建等。完全覆盖 Issue #23 规格。✅
C-测试: 当前提交无测试文件(*spec.ts / *test.ts / __tests__)。前端框架搭建阶段可接受,但后续功能模块(用户管理、大屏等)请在对应 Issue 中补充单元测试。⚠️
*spec.ts
*test.ts
__tests__
D-代码质量: request.ts Axios 封装规范(拦截器/Token/错误码映射完善)、路由懒加载结构清晰、MainLayout.vue 布局组件合理。代码命名规范、异常处理到位。✅
request.ts
MainLayout.vue
审核通过,关闭。
Bir bölümü silmek kalıcıdır. Geri almanın bir yolu yoktur.
任务:前端项目框架搭建
内容
参考
见 docs/architecture.md 第一节
交付物
估时
8 人日
设计文档已更新: docs/design-spec.md 对应章节: 1.1 frontend/前端结构 + 5.1 大屏组件树 请参照该章节的数据库DDL、API端点规范、前端组件树、数据流图进行开发。
✅ 开发完成
提交: 71182e2e (feature/dev) 文件变更: 26个文件,4078行代码新增,1444行代码删除
实现功能
请审核。
✅ PM 审核通过
A-git: 远程分支
feature/dev存在,commit71182e2e提交信息清晰,明确引用 Issue #23。✅B-文件: 26 个文件变更(+4078/-1444),覆盖 Vue3 + TypeScript + Element Plus 项目初始化、认证系统(登录/注册/忘记密码)、主布局组件 + 路由系统、用户管理模块、供水总览大屏可视化、Axios 封装 + API 模块、ECharts 图表、ESLint + Prettier 规范、Vite 构建等。完全覆盖 Issue #23 规格。✅
C-测试: 当前提交无测试文件(
*spec.ts/*test.ts/__tests__)。前端框架搭建阶段可接受,但后续功能模块(用户管理、大屏等)请在对应 Issue 中补充单元测试。⚠️D-代码质量:
request.tsAxios 封装规范(拦截器/Token/错误码映射完善)、路由懒加载结构清晰、MainLayout.vue布局组件合理。代码命名规范、异常处理到位。✅审核通过,关闭。